I did do a LS3 Polluter cam, these heads with stock LS3 10.8:1 compression and a Fast 102 for a guy in Florida who has been low 10.90's@127-128 on his 2nd trip to the track I believe. In a full weight 6 speed 4th gen F-body with that combo. He's only been 1.62-1.64 60' and racing in 2500-3000DA. Also shifting at 6700rpm right now so he's got some more room to grow for sure. Should be a solid 10.40-10.50 car once it's sorted out.
That combo made 505-510rwhp and 460rwtq through a Dana S60.

For those wondering what i'm building its a LSx 454 620hp 4.185"+ 0.010" crate motor block, destroking with a 4.000K1 crank, 6.125" rods. Custom pistons. TEA prepped TFS GenX LS3 heads with powdered steal guides, light weight intake valves and decked for around 11.7:1 comp. Custom Tick Performance cam. GMPP single plane intake.
Going in a 3100lb Aussie muscle car, Modded TR6060. 3.7:1 diff. 27" tyre.
